In a heartfelt comedy‑drama that balances laugh‑out‑loud moments with genuine tenderness, Kevin Hart leads an ensemble cast through the everyday chaos of modern parenthood. Set against a bustling suburban backdrop, the film captures the rhythm of family life—school pickups, grocery aisles, and weekend outings—while letting the audience feel the weight of love that both comforts and complicates. The tone is conversational and warm, inviting viewers to smile at the absurdities of single‑parent life without ever losing sight of its deeper emotional currents.

At the story’s core is Matthew Logelin, a devoted father who suddenly finds himself solely responsible for his newborn daughter after a life‑changing loss. Hart’s performance blends his signature humor with a quiet, earnest determination, portraying a man learning to navigate diapers, sleepless nights, and the unspoken pressures of providing stability for his child. The premise follows his journey from bewildered newcomer to a confident, if imperfect, caretaker, highlighting the delicate balance between self‑sacrifice and personal growth.

Around Matthew swirl a cast of supportive, often comic, characters who shape his new reality. His best friends—Jordan and Oscar—offer banter and practical help, while his mother Anna and his late wife’s parents, Marion and Mike, bring generational perspectives on love and loss. A tentative romance with Swan hints at the possibility of new beginnings, and his boss Howard represents both professional challenge and unexpected opportunity. Together, these relationships create a vibrant tapestry that underscores the film’s message: family isn’t defined solely by blood, but by the community that rallies around you when life throws its toughest curveballs.
